AFRICAN DEVELOPMENT BANK

REQUEST FOR EXPRESSIONS OF INTEREST

INDIVIDUAL CONSULTANT – ATAF WOMEN IN TAX NETWORK

Financing Agreement reference: African Development Bank Grant no: 2100155032416

Project ID No.: P-Z1-K00-059

 

 

 

African Tax Administration Forum (ATAF) has received financing from the African Development Bank toward the cost of the Regional Institutional Support Project on Public Financial Governance (RISPFG).

ATAF seeks to procure the services of an Individual consultant to assist in developing an ATAF Women in Tax Network.

The Terms of Reference are attached hereto, and the responsibility of the individual consultant is included in the Terms of Reference.

ATAF now invites eligible candidates to indicate their interest in providing these services. Interested applicants must provide information indicating that they are qualified to perform the services.

The Individual Consultant is expected to have among others the following key competencies : A Master’s degree or equivalent in Taxation, Women in leadership, Law, Business administration and any other related field; (ii) Minimum 7 years of demonstrated work experience in analysis of tax administration, tax policy and leadership; (iii) At least 5 years of demonstrated experience in undertaking similar work within the African region on tax and gender and have a broad understanding of the socio- economic dynamics of African countries; (iv) Demonstrable work experience in undertaking research activities/field work; (v) Should have an in-depth knowledge of the tax systems in Africa; (vi) Good report writing skills; Experience in designing and facilitating multi-stakeholder seminars and meetings for international regional or bilateral development organisations; (vii) Good command of the written and spoken English language; and or French and a good working knowledge of the other and (ix) Computer literacy.

Eligibility criteria, establishment of the short-list and the selection procedure shall be in accordance with the African Development Bank’s “Procurement Policy for Bank Group Funded Operations, October 2015,” which is available on the Bank’s website at http://www.afdb.org.
